DESCRIPTION:ABOUT THE EVENT:\n\nThe Department of Electronics and Communica
 tion Engineering (ECE)\, G. Pullaiah College of Engineering and Technology
  (Autonomous)\, successfully organized an expert lecture titled “Augment
 ing Human Intelligence with AI &amp; Robotics in Industry 5.0” as part of ac
 ademic and research enrichment activities. The session was conducted with 
 the objective of providing participants with a deeper understanding of how
  artificial intelligence and robotics are transforming industrial systems 
 by enhancing human intelligence rather than replacing it.The lecture was d
 elivered by Dr. Rajesh Kaluri\, Professor at Vellore Institute of Technolo
 gy (VIT)\, Vellore\, a distinguished academician with 20 years of experien
 ce in artificial intelligence\, robotics\, and intelligent systems. Dr. Ka
 luri elaborated on the evolution of industrial revolutions from Industry 1
 .0 to Industry 5.0\, emphasizing the shift toward human-centric\, ethical\
 , and collaborative intelligent systems.During the session\, the resource 
 person discussed the role of AI and robotics in augmenting human capabilit
 ies through decision-support systems\, collaborative robots\, emotional in
 telligence\, and agent-based AI frameworks. He highlighted how advanced AI
  techniques such as deep learning\, neural networks\, and multimodal commu
 nication enable natural interaction between humans and machines. Practical
  examples from academia and industry were presented to illustrate the real
 -world impact of human–robot collaboration.The lecture also addressed em
 erging research challenges and opportunities in Industry 5.0\, including e
 thical AI\, workforce augmentation\, and sustainable automation. Dr. Kalur
 i emphasized the importance of aligning technological advancements with hu
 man values\, inclusivity\, and societal well-being. The session encouraged
  participants to explore interdisciplinary research and innovation in AI-d
 riven human–machine systems.The program witnessed active participation f
 rom faculty members and students. An interactive question-and-answer sessi
 on followed\, during which the resource person addressed queries related t
 o research directions\, AI applications\, and career opportunities in Indu
 stry 5.0. The interactive discussions significantly enhanced participants
 ’ understanding and research orientation.Overall\, the expert lecture se
 rved as an excellent platform for academic enrichment and knowledge exchan
 ge. The session contributed to strengthening participants’ awareness of 
 emerging AI and robotics technologies and their role in shaping the future
  of human-centric industrial systems.\n\nEVENT PICTURES:\n\nCONCLUSION:\n\
